Santiago de la Ribera enjoys a Mediterranean climate, with average temperatures ranging between 12°C and 26°C annually. The area receives ample sunshine, contributing to a pleasant environment for outdoor activities for a significant portion of the year. The water temperature in the Mar Menor reaches 20°C or higher for approximately five months, indicating a suitable swimming season. The town is situated at an elevation of 9 metres above sea level, offering a low-lying coastal setting. The terrain leading to the nearest beach has a gentle gradient of 2.0%, signifying a flat approach.

San Javier is a small town and municipality in the autonomous community and province of Murcia in southeastern Spain. The municipality is situated at the northern end of Murcia's Mediterranean coastline, the Costa Cálida.
|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 11.7°C | 31 mm |
| February | 12.0°C | 21 mm |
| March | 14.4°C | 26 mm |
| April | 16.3°C | 26 mm |
| May | 19.1°C | 25 mm |
| June | 22.9°C | 8 mm |
| July | 25.8°C | 2 mm |
| August | 26.4°C | 3 mm |
| September | 23.9°C | 21 mm |
| October | 19.9°C | 38 mm |
| November | 15.8°C | 36 mm |
| December | 12.4°C | 30 mm |
